General Karting Helmet FAQ
What is the best helmet for kart racing?The Schuberth SK1 Carbon Fiber kart helmet is widely considered one of the best karting helmets for youth drivers. Its lightweight shell, superior visibility, and professional-level safety features make it a top-tier choice.
Why do I need a racing helmet?A certified racing helmet protects against high-speed impacts and debris. In many motorsports, it also offers fire protection. For karting, helmets like the SK1 are designed for optimized safety, comfort, and performance.
How do I choose the right size kart racing helmet?Use a flexible measuring tape to measure the circumference of your head just above your eyebrows. Match your measurement to the brand’s official size chart to ensure a snug, safe fit.
What safety standards should I look for in a kart racing helmet?Look for Snell K2020 (for adult karting) or FIA CMR2016 (for youth). These certifications guarantee impact protection and are recognized by racing organizations worldwide.
Can I use a motorcycle helmet for kart racing?No. Motorcycle helmets typically lack kart-specific features like proper ventilation and kart-specific safety certifications. Use only a kart-rated helmet like the Schuberth SK1 for competition.
How often should I replace my kart racing helmet?Replace every 5 years or sooner if your helmet has been dropped, impacted, or shows signs of wear. Even if it appears undamaged, materials degrade over time.
Are expensive racing helmets safer than budget ones?Yes, typically. Premium helmets offer better materials, superior fit, enhanced ventilation, and lower weight—all contributing to reduced fatigue and better performance.
How do I maintain and clean my kart racing helmet?Use a helmet-safe cleaner like the Molecule Helmet Care Kit. Avoid abrasives and never submerge your helmet. Gently clean visors with a microfiber cloth.
Do I need to wear a balaclava under my kart racing helmet?Not always required, but highly recommended. Balaclavas add comfort, keep the interior clean, wick away sweat, and protect ears during helmet removal.
Can I wear glasses with my kart racing helmet?Yes. The Schuberth SK1 features a wide eyeport and is compatible with most prescription glasses and racing eyewear.
Are carbon fiber helmets better?Yes. Carbon fiber helmets are stronger and lighter, reducing strain during long races and offering exceptional impact protection.
Can I use a used helmet for racing?It’s not recommended. Damage is not always visible. Helmets degrade over time, and a used helmet may not meet current safety standards. Buy new from trusted dealers like Competition Motorsport.
How can I prevent helmet fogging?Use a Pinlock® anti-fog visor or apply anti-fog spray. Helmets like the SK1 include anti-fog inserts to maintain clear vision during racing.
Why is helmet ventilation important?Good ventilation helps regulate temperature and moisture, reducing fatigue and maintaining focus—especially in hot, demanding races.
How do I store my kart helmet between races?Keep it in a cool, dry area away from sunlight. Use a padded helmet bag to protect it from scratches and impacts during transport or storage.
What's the difference between Snell K2020 and CMR2016?Snell K2020 is designed for adults and emphasizes impact protection. CMR2016 is required for drivers under 15, offering lighter construction to protect developing neck and spine structures.
Are tear-off visors necessary for karting?Yes, especially in outdoor environments. Tear-offs help maintain visibility by allowing drivers to quickly remove dirty visor layers mid-race.
How do I know if my helmet is still safe?Inspect it for cracks, fading, loose padding, or visible wear. If the helmet has been in an accident or is more than 5 years old, replace it immediately.
Can I customize my kart helmet?Yes, many brands allow custom fitment and paint jobs. However, avoid drilling or altering the structure, as that can void certifications and reduce safety.

Why Rotor Design Matters: Heat Expansion and Floating Technology
As with most metals, iron brake discs expand significantly under heat. When temperatures rise, the disc grows radially—expanding in both diameter and circumference. Traditional one-piece rotors struggle to accommodate this natural expansion. As the outer edge pulls away from the center under heat stress, it creates a condition called “coning”—a distortion that compromises pad-to-rotor contact. This distortion can lead to uneven pad wear, brake tapering, and an inconsistent, long brake pedal.
AP Racing two-piece floating brake rotors are purpose-built to eliminate these issues. Engineered with “float” built into the disc or hat assembly, these rotors feature oblong-shaped mounting holes that allow the hardware to slide as the disc heats up. This flexibility ensures the disc runs true within the caliper under high-temperature loads, effectively reducing distortion, minimizing pad taper and stress cracks, and promoting longer component life.
Custom Mounting Hardware & Anti-Knockback Spring Clips
AP Racing rotors utilize application-specific, U.S.-made mounting hardware—not generic bolts. These premium components are the exact parts used in AP’s professional motorsport products, engineered to withstand the rigors of competitive racing.
To manage lateral disc motion that can push caliper pistons backward (known as knockback), AP Racing integrates anti-knockback spring clips on alternating bobbins—five on a ten-bolt setup, six on a twelve-bolt disc. These clips keep the aluminum hat and iron disc ring properly aligned while still allowing for radial float. Bonus: they eliminate annoying rattles and vibrations, ensuring a quieter, more refined braking experience.
High-Performance Hat Design for Heat Isolation
The disc hats in AP Racing’s two-piece floating rotors are CNC-machined from 6061-T6 billet aluminum and finished with a hard anodized coating. This high-strength aluminum alloy was selected for its ability to maintain structural integrity even at elevated temperatures. AP adds scalloped channels beneath the hat to further encourage airflow and heat evacuation from the outer disc face, minimizing thermal transfer to hubs and wheel bearings—helping reduce maintenance costs on these expensive components.
Internal Vane Engineering: Airflow Optimization & Thermal Stability
AP Racing’s internal vane design sets them apart from OEM and most aftermarket competitors. While many factory brake discs use non-directional pillar vanes (low-cost and NVH-focused), AP Racing rotors use directional vanes engineered for maximum airflow. These rotors are side-specific—meaning you’ll receive a unique left and right disc in each set—ensuring optimized cooling through strategic vane orientation and shape.
Beyond that, AP Racing rotors feature a superior vane count, typically ranging from 60 to 84 vanes, compared to 30–48 in most aftermarket rotors. After extensive CFD and thermal analysis, this high vane count was proven to:
Increase airspeed and thermal transfer
Reduce recirculation and deflection at the disc face
Minimize coning, cracking, and brake fade
Deliver more even pad contact and extended rotor life
J Hook Slot Pattern: Exclusive to AP Racing
Slots and drill holes may improve initial bite, but they also introduce “cool spots” in the rotor face—areas of uneven heating that can lead to stress risers, cracks, and pad vibration. OEM rotors often avoid this by leaving the disc face blank, but that compromises bite and brake feel.
AP Racing’s patented J Hook design, developed through rigorous R&D, solves this problem. The hooks are meticulously spaced around the disc’s circumference and from hat to edge, forming a continuous distortion path that ensures even heat distribution. This encourages uniform pad deposits during bed-in, helps reduce judder and cracking, and improves consistency under repeated high-load braking.
In addition, the J Hook slots provide more leading edges for pads to grip than traditional curved slots or blank rotors. While this might generate a mild whirring sound during braking, the benefits—more bite, cleaner bedding, better pedal feel—make it the top choice for committed racers and serious track day drivers.

Bedding and Preparation of AP Racing J Hook Discs
Properly preparing your new brake discs before heavy use is extremely important. The goal of bedding-in your brake pads and discs is to mate them together properly and prepare them for heavy use. When prepared properly, or bed-in, your pads will transfer a thin layer of material to the disc face (transfer layer). The pads in your caliper will then actually ride on that thin layer of pad material you’ve put down on the rotor, rather than rubbing directly on the iron rotor face. A good transfer layer is going to give you superior brake pedal feel, less noise, superior pad wear, and lower the chances of cracking your discs.
Important Notes- PLEASE READ! First, make sure you are on a closed course to perform a proper bed-in. Do NOT perform the procedure on public roads. You need a stretch of asphalt with long straights, good visibility, and no potential obstructions. Make sure you are in a position to safely and repeatedly attain the necessary speeds to perform the bed-in procedure. A controlled racetrack is the best place to perform this procedure. AP Racing and Competition Motorsport in no way suggest or condone speeding on public roads or breaking the law in your car, nor do we take responsibility for any damage or injury that occurs as a result of using our product or these procedures. You are performing the bed-in procedure at your own risk.
During these procedures, it’s critical that you never come to a complete stop with your foot on the brake pedal. If you have brake ducts on your car, you may want to block them off to allow your brake system to heat up easily. The procedure outlined below is a generic procedure for most types of mild race pad. Please check your pad manufacturer’s recommended bed-in procedure.
Accelerate to approximately 60mph and then decelerate down to 5 mph. If your car has ABS, you should try to hold the brakes at a point just before ABS intervention.
Once the car slows to 5mph, immediately accelerate back up to about 60mph, and brake again to roughly 5mph.
Repeat this series of stopping and accelerating 8 to 10 times. Again, do not come to a complete stop with your foot on the brake pedal.
Cool the brake system down by cruising at 45mph+ for 5 to 10 minutes.
Visually inspect your discs. They should be a blue/grey color (instead of shiny silver), and have an even layer of pad material across and around the entire rotor face.
If the AP Racing rotors don’t have a layer of pad material on them, perform another series of stops in the manner outlined above.

The Girodisc system is an upgrade to a two-piece steel rotor and aluminum hat combination and is a direct replacement1 for the OEM brake rotors. These two-piece floating rotors will bolt directly to the car and work with your OEM calipers perfectly. By upgrading your brakes with these lightweight, high-performance replacements (as opposed to a big brake kit), your factory brake bias is maintained, along with your ABS efficiency.
Girodisc two-piece floating rotors are lighter than traditional cast iron brake rotors. This reduction in rotational mass and unsprung weight allows for quicker acceleration, sharper steering, and faster suspension response.
When used with Pagid or PFC performance brake pads, and Competition Motorsport RF-1 racing brake fluid, you have an amazing solution to overheating, cracking and warping rotors.
The central hat section of the disc is made from 6061-T6 aircraft specification aluminum. The disc is manufactured from cast iron constructed in the USA, made to the same specification with the same material used by professional racing organizations. The rotors' curved vane design was developed in racing and acts as a centrifugal pump to force cooling air through the disc.
The rotor and hat mount together through a floating mount system which utilizes ten high strength alloy steel drive pins manufactured by Girodisc in the USA to their own specifications and are cadmium plated for corrosion resistance. The alloy drive pins transfer the load from braking while maintaining the axial and radial float between the disc rotor and hat. The pins are secured by Grade-12 cap screws with hardened washers and mounted with anti-noise spring washers to allow for heat expansion while eliminating the rattle and noise associated with floating rotors.
The two-piece Girodisc design allows for disc-only replacement as well, minimizing future replacement costs and delivering outstanding performance.
Sold/priced per pair.
1 Note: These Girodisc rotors have a different annulus (pad swept area) than the OEM CCM rotors, to maintain their light weight. A brake pad with an annulus of 66mm or less must be used with these Girodisc rotors.
The necessary pad shape is very common, found on the Nissan GT-R, Cadillac CTS-V, and most AMG Mercedes equipped with six-piston calipers.

Competition Carbon Components (C3 Carbon) has been steadily gaining in popularity amongst today’s high-performance driving enthusiasts due to several key factors that help C3 Carbon stand out in a market full of sub-par aftermarket offerings. Each C3 Carbon product is manufactured to provide perfect fit and extreme strength while reducing weight, maximizing quality and ensuring years of exceptional finish. We provide all of this for significantly less money than OEM parts.
Every product we make uses pre-impregnated dry carbon formed in a CNC-machined billet aluminum mold which is manufactured by laser-scanning the OEM component(s) so you know you’ll have a perfect fit, every time. Dry carbon is stronger and lighter than wet carbon, often weighing 1/3 of our competitors’ products. Our manufacturing methods also produce a smoother surface on each part for more dimensional accuracy; shaving edges, widening mounting holes and flexing pieces to make them fit are a thing of the past.
C3 Carbon also applies an automotive urethane clear-coat which is U/V cured for durability and guarantees C3 Carbon parts won't yellow over time.
Many of our competitors use wet carbon (which is heavier), and some use fiberglass with a carbon overlay (much heavier, as the carbon fiber has epoxy literally painted onto it). These materials and manufacturing methods produce a poor finish due to air contamination, and because the epoxy isn’t applied uniformly throughout the weave. These products are also much weaker than C3 Carbon products. Finally, most competitors use a fiberglass mold, which is far less expensive but cannot maintain the strict tolerances we demand of our own products. In the end, the fit and finish simply cannot stand up to C3 Carbon products.
